0.1.26 • Published 3 years ago

vue-bpmn-designer v0.1.26

Weekly downloads
-
License
MIT
Repository
-
Last release
3 years ago

Jeecg 流程设计器

如何切换activity和flowable

  • 修改VueBpmnDesigner.vue文件moddleType,可选值flowable,activiti
return {
   //引擎类型flowable,activiti
   moddleType:'activiti',
   ...
}

后台接口配置

  • vue.config.js中配置接口地址
devServer: {
    port: 8000,
    proxy: {
      '/act': {
        target: 'http://localhost:8088',
        changeOrigin: true
      }
    }
  }

接口地址

  • packages/api/index.js
process: {
    //获取流程
    getProcess: "act/designer/getProcessXml",
    //用户列表
    userList: "act/designer/getUsers",
    //角色列表
    groupList: "act/designer/getGroups",
    //表达式
    expressionList: "act/designer/getExpressions",
    //监听
    getListenersByType: "act/designer/getListenersByType",
    //保存流程
    processSave: "act/designer/saveProcess",
  }

安装

npm install

运行

npm run serve

构建

npm run build

打包

npm run lib

发布

npm run publish
0.1.30

3 years ago

0.1.29

3 years ago

0.1.20

3 years ago

0.1.22

3 years ago

0.1.23

3 years ago

0.1.24

3 years ago

0.1.25

3 years ago

0.1.26

3 years ago

0.1.27

3 years ago

0.1.28

3 years ago

0.1.19

3 years ago

0.1.17

3 years ago

0.1.18

3 years ago

0.1.16

3 years ago

0.1.15

3 years ago

0.1.14

3 years ago

0.1.12

3 years ago

0.1.11

3 years ago

0.1.10

3 years ago

0.1.9

3 years ago

0.1.8

3 years ago

0.1.6

3 years ago

0.1.5

3 years ago